Why Analysts Watch Saudi Arabia From Space
Saudi Arabia is monitored for the infrastructure that moves world energy — the Ras Tanura terminal and East-West pipeline — and for giga-projects like NEOM that are redrawing the northwest coast at unprecedented construction scale. Red Sea shipping disruptions lap at its western ports.
Typical monitoring angles
- Tanker loadings at Ras Tanura and Gulf terminals with SAR detection
- NEOM and giga-project earthworks tracked scene-by-scene in Sentinel-2
- Red Sea shipping patterns at Jeddah and Yanbu under regional disruption
